How to use UniScan to track Bitcoin transactions? (Explorer Guide)
UniScan offers a clean, responsive Bitcoin blockchain explorer with real-time TX/address/block search, Taproot & coinjoin support, advanced filters, and full script decoding—all on mainnet by default.

Understanding UniScan Interface
1. UniScan presents a clean, responsive dashboard where users input Bitcoin transaction IDs, addresses, or block hashes directly into the search bar located at the top center of the page.
2. The interface defaults to BTC mainnet mode, ensuring all queries resolve against the live Bitcoin blockchain without requiring manual network selection.
3. Real-time status indicators appear beside each search result, showing confirmation count, timestamp, and fee rate in satoshis per virtual byte.
4. Hovering over any output script reveals its type—P2PKH, P2SH, P2WPKH, or P2TR—with corresponding address formats displayed in both legacy and Bech32m variants.
5. Transaction graphs render UTXO flow visually, mapping inputs to outputs with directional arrows and color-coded value labels.
Navigating Transaction Details
1. Clicking on a transaction hash opens a dedicated detail view containing raw hex data, decoded scriptSig and scriptWitness fields, and full signature validation status.
2. Each input displays the previous output’s transaction ID and index, along with the unlocking script’s execution result—success or failure—and associated error code if applicable.
3. Outputs are listed with precise satoshi amounts, locking script opcodes, and whether they have been spent in subsequent blocks.
4. A collapsible “Related Transactions” section shows all transactions linked through shared inputs or outputs, enabling chain tracing across multiple hops.
5. Timestamps reflect actual block inclusion time, not broadcast time, and are cross-verified against the median time past of the confirming block’s parent chain.
Monitoring Address Activity
1. Entering a Bitcoin address triggers an overview showing total received, sent, and final balance in both BTC and satoshis, updated instantly upon new confirmations.
2. The address page lists all confirmed transactions chronologically, with newest entries first, and includes pagination controls supporting up to 10,000 records per request.
3. Each transaction row highlights whether it is inbound, outbound, or self-transfer based on input/output ownership heuristics applied by UniScan’s clustering engine.
4. Balance history charts plot daily net flow, revealing accumulation or distribution patterns without relying on external APIs or third-party analytics feeds.
5. QR code generation is available for any address shown, rendered inline using SVG format with customizable size and margin parameters.
Using Advanced Search Filters
1. The advanced search panel allows filtering by minimum/maximum confirmation count, transaction size in bytes, fee range, and inclusion within specific block height intervals.
2. Users may combine filters to isolate low-fee transactions stuck in mempool or identify high-value transfers exceeding 1 BTC in a single output.
3. Script pattern matching supports regular expressions targeting specific opcodes like OP_CHECKMULTISIG or OP_RETURN payloads containing ASCII text or hex-encoded metadata.
4. Export options include CSV and JSON formats, preserving all decoded fields including sighash flags, sequence numbers, and witness commitment hashes where present.
5. Search history persists locally in browser storage and remains accessible across sessions unless manually cleared by the user.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Does UniScan support SegWit v1 (Taproot) transaction decoding?Yes. UniScan fully decodes Taproot spends, displaying internal key, script path spend details, and Merkle branch verification status for each witness element.
Q: Can I verify if a transaction is replaceable via RBF?Yes. UniScan explicitly marks transactions with opt-in RBF enabled by checking the sequence number of each input against the BIP125 standard.
Q: Is there a rate limit on API access when using UniScan programmatically?Public API endpoints enforce a limit of 60 requests per minute per IP address; no authentication is required for basic transaction lookups.
Q: How does UniScan handle coinjoin transactions?UniScan identifies common coinjoin signatures such as those from Wasabi Wallet or Samourai Whirlpool and labels them accordingly, while preserving full input/output transparency without obfuscation.
